The Corrosion Inhibition Effect of Thiourea for Q235 steel in Oxalic Acid Solution

This work is dedicated to exploring the optimum concentration and anti-corrosion mechanism of pickling agent that can effectively remove corrosion products of high-speed railway trains. A commonly used oxalic acid cleaning agent with thiourea was diluted to 5%, 10%, 15%, and 20%. Based on EIS and Tafel tests, we found that thiourea could provide efficient protection for Q235 steel when the diluted concentration was 5%. Meanwhile, thiourea was a modest and mixed corrosion inhibitor for Q235 steel in oxalic acid. SEM observation further proved the above conclusion. According to theoretical calculation, the high E-HOMO, E-binding and low E-LUMO, Delta E values of thiourea stood for the excellent adsorption ability and supreme anti-corrosion performance.
